summaryrefslogtreecommitdiff
path: root/src (unfollow)
Commit message (Expand)AuthorFilesLines
2023-04-17Drop GF2m teststb1-647/+1
2023-04-17Allow overriding the bc implementation used in run-bctb1-2/+7
2023-04-17Fix typotb1-2/+2
2023-04-17Drop two useless READMEstb2-18/+0
2023-04-17Skip sect* curve checkstb1-2/+2
2023-04-17c_zlib.c needs bio_local.h with -DZLIB.tb1-1/+2
2023-04-17Tweak indent and use named registers.jsing1-13/+13
2023-04-17Hook sha3 up to build.jsing1-1/+3
2023-04-17Move BN_bn2mpi()/BN_mpi2bn() into bn_convert.cjsing3-138/+74
2023-04-17Use C99 initializers for the default_pctx and mark it static consttb1-8/+3
2023-04-17Add missing const qualifiers to the v3_* externstb1-11/+11
2023-04-17Fix whitespace in DHparam_print_fp()tb1-2/+4
2023-04-17Remove now unused dh_prn.ctb1-64/+0
2023-04-17Drop dh_prn.ctb1-2/+1
2023-04-17Move DHparam_print_fp() next to DHparam_print()tb2-17/+18
2023-04-17remove bad Pp;jmc1-3/+2
2023-04-16Fix previous: add a missing andtb1-2/+3
2023-04-16Dump (leak) info using utrace(2) and compile the code always inotto2-148/+199
2023-04-16Garbage collect the now unused obfuscating macro string_stack_free()tb1-4/+1
2023-04-16Inline the three uses of string_stack_free()tb1-4/+4
2023-04-16Remove the now unused vpm_int.htb1-64/+0
2023-04-16x509_vfy.c and x509_vpm.c don't need vpm_int.h anymoretb2-4/+4
2023-04-16Move X509_VERIFY_PARAM_st from vpm_int.h to x509_local.htb2-13/+13
2023-04-16Provide EVP methods for SHA3 224/256/384/512.jsing3-2/+193
2023-04-16Provide EVP methods for SHA512/224 and SHA512/256.jsing4-4/+91
2023-04-16Bounds check mdlen that is passed to sha3_init().jsing1-2/+5
2023-04-16Shuffle ext_cmp() and ext_list_free() up a bittb1-18/+14
2023-04-16Remove unnecessary prototypes in the middle of the codetb1-5/+1
2023-04-16Use more usual version of inlined nitems(). No binary change.tb1-2/+2
2023-04-16Fix comment formatting and grammar, drop usless and outdated commenttb1-7/+3
2023-04-16Remove now empty/unused ext_dat.htb1-67/+0
2023-04-16Merge ext_dat.h back into x509_lib.ctb2-78/+78
2023-04-16Mark X9.31 BN API for removaltb1-1/+4
2023-04-16The BN reciprocal API will also become internal-onlytb1-1/+7
2023-04-16Various BN*init() will be removed from the public APItb1-1/+10
2023-04-16Mark public bn_nist and ec_nist API for removaltb2-2/+6
2023-04-16Mark EC_KEY_{get,insert}_method_data() for removaltb1-1/+5
2023-04-16Mark TS_VERIFY_CTX_init() for removaltb1-1/+3
2023-04-16Prepare addition of X509_STORE_CTX_get1_{certs,crls}(3)tb2-2/+27
2023-04-16Mark remaining policy tree public API for removaltb2-3/+19
2023-04-16Annotate policy tree STACK_OF() goo for removal from public APItb1-1/+4
2023-04-16The policy tree types become internal ony. Annotate them.tb1-1/+7
2023-04-16Cipher text stealing will go away. Mark it for removal.tb1-1/+3
2023-04-16Mark proxy policy API for removal in upcoming bumptb1-1/+5
2023-04-16Remove the now unused ex_pcpathlen from the X509 structtb1-2/+1
2023-04-16More ProxyCertInfo tentacles go to the attictb2-65/+6
2023-04-16Remove some dead code from the new verifiertb1-7/+1
2023-04-16Drop support for the ProxyCertInfo extensiontb1-3/+2
2023-04-16Make pcy_int.h pull in x509_local.h it will need it soontb1-1/+4
2023-04-15ec_point_conversion: do not rely on ec.h pulling in bn.htb1-1/+2